About the role
At Connect Design, we specialise in creating accessible educational and business resources, offering high-quality braille, large print, audio, and easy-read solutions. With over 35 years of expertise, we empower everyone to access vital information.
Due to continued expansion, we are seeking an Operations Manager to oversee the day-to-day running of our studio and support the wider management team in delivering a high-performing, collaborative, and efficient working environment.
This is a pivotal new role in the business — ideal for someone experienced in operations or studio management who thrives in a dynamic SME setting and wants to contribute to meaningful, impactful work.
What you'll do:
* Oversee day-to-day studio operations and workflow traffic management.
* Forecast and schedule workloads, adapting to changing project demands and making timely decisions to maintain seamless production, ensuring proposed targets and SLAs are achievable and delivered within agreed timeframes
* Lead and support departmental leads across creative and administrative teams, ensuring effective resourcing, operational coordination, and delivery against team targets and KPI's.
* Work closely with teams to build a detailed understanding of the products and services handled by each department to support effective planning and decision-making.
* Serve as the day-to-day operational contact for internal and external stakeholders, ensuring clear communication, managed expectations, and timely, high-quality project delivery.
* Champion a customer-centric approach by overseeing client onboarding and maintaining high standards of service whilst building strong relationships with new and existing clients.
* Ensure studio activities consistently meet agreed quality standards, SLAs, KPIs, and internal quality and security requirements.
* Support the implementation of production systems, studio processes, and continuous improvement initiatives by working with the senior management team to identify opportunities for efficiency and improvement.
* Analyse operational data and prepare reports to support strategic planning and informed decision-making.
* Identify and promptly escalate operational risks or issues to the Operations Director.
* Promote and maintain a positive, collaborative culture that aligns with company values.
